Shirt print fabrics refer to textile materials that feature designs or patterns printed onto the surface. These prints can range from bold graphics and intricate floral designs to minimalist patterns and abstract art. The choice of fabric type, such as cotton, linen, or polyester, alongside the print, can dramatically affect the overall look and feel of a shirt. Cotton, for instance, remains a favorite due to its breathability and softness, making it ideal for casual wear, while polyester blends are often used for more formal applications due to their durability and wrinkle resistance.

Moreover, advancements in printing technology have opened new avenues for creativity in shirt design. Digital printing, for example, allows for high-resolution, detailed prints that can be customized for individual preferences. Unlike traditional methods, digital printing minimizes fabric waste, making it an environmentally friendly option. This innovation has spurred an increase in demand for bespoke and limited-edition shirts, as consumers lean towards unique and personalized clothing choices.
Sustainability in fashion has also influenced the evolution of shirt print fabrics. Many brands are now focusing on eco-friendly fabric options and sustainable printing methods to reduce their environmental impact. Organic cotton, hemp, and recycled polyester are gaining traction as environmentally conscious choices that do not compromise on style. As consumers become more aware of their purchasing habits, the demand for sustainable shirt print fabrics is expected to rise.
